The amount of arsenic pentasulphide that can be obtained when35.5 garsenic acid is treated with excessH2Sin the presence of conc.HCl(assuming100%conversion) is

Options:

Answer:
D
Solution:

2H3AsO4+5H2SConc.HClAs2S5+8H2O

2moles of Arsenic Acid1mole of Arsenic Pentasulphide

1moles of Arsenic Acid1/2mole of Arsenic Pentasulphide

Molar mass of H3AsO4=141; Molar mass of As2S5=308

Number of moles ofH3AsO4=35.5141=0.25

 Number of moles ofAs2S5=0.252=0.125 mol
